Volvo C30, S40 and V50 recall

July 8, 2011

Volvo is carrying out a voluntary recall of the following models:

  • Volvo C30production period 2008 to 2011
  • Volvo S40production period 2008 to 2011
  • Volvo V50production period 2008 to 2011

This recall is due to an issue with the brake booster system, which could lead to the brake pedal becoming harder than normal to push and increased force would be required to stop the car.

The recall involves 1,320 vehicles in Ireland.

What to do:

Letters will be sent by Volvo to customers informing them of the recall.  Consumers affected by this recall should contact their nearest Volvo dealer to arrange for the brake vacuum hose to be replaced if required and modified.

Any work carried out as part of this recall will be completed free of charge.
